Chicago Inclusion Project to Offer Pay-What-You-Can Training Program
The Chicago Inclusion Project is launching a new training program for artists in underrepresented communities. The Professional Performance Training Series is built in association with Jackalope and Steppenwolf theaters and will operate under a pay-what-you-can model. The series will consist of masterclasses, workshops, and mentor lectures from Chicago theater luminaries....
League to Honor Nussbaum, Free Street, and Aguijón at Gala
The League of Chicago Theatres has announced the recipients of honors at its 40th Anniversary gala, Monday, May 20, 2019 at the Palmer House Hilton. Theater Wit Announces Cast & Staff for “Admissions”
Theater Wit has announced the cast for the Chicago premiere of Joshua Harmon’s “Admissions,” a satire about liberal white America through the lens of racial diversity in private schools.
